     34       1.1       gwr /*
     35      1.11        pk  * This implements a general-purpose memory-disk.
     36      1.13    jeremy  * See md.h for notes on the config types.
     37       1.1       gwr  *
     38       1.1       gwr  * Note that this driver provides the same functionality
     39       1.1       gwr  * as the MFS filesystem hack, but this is better because
     40       1.1       gwr  * you can use this for any filesystem type you'd like!
     41       1.1       gwr  *
     42       1.1       gwr  * Credit for most of the kmem ramdisk code goes to:
     43       1.1       gwr  *   Leo Weppelman (atari) and Phil Nelson (pc532)
     44      1.11        pk  * Credit for the ideas behind the "user space memory" code goes
     45       1.1       gwr  * to the authors of the MFS implementation.
     46       1.1       gwr  */
